In device manager if you notice any yellow, kinda exclamation marks. That means the drivers have not been installed

The drivers are either on your motherboard CD (if you have one) or can easily be downloded from your computers (or motherboard) manufactures website (which is normally preferred)

To answer further questions regarding drivers, you may need to tell me what computer you have, and what Windows you are using.
